My 8 yr old sister has a runny nose, chills, fever of 100.0, and coughing. should we jut give her tylenol (acetaminophen)? does she just have a cold or is it the flu?

Sure and viral: Tylenol (acetaminophen) is fine for symptomatic relief of aches and fever with a viral infection. Motrin will work a little better at pain relief and lasts 6 to 8 hours as opposed to tylenol (acetaminophen) which lasts 4 hours. She has either a cold or a fever it sounds like. The low grade fever is more suggestive of a typical viral cold, usually influenza will yield high fevers, shaking chills, headaches, and eye pain.
